.DISCUSSION...

Typically warm and humid conditions will prevail into the early
portion of the coming week, with many chances for rain.
The most widespread showers and thunderstorms, any of which could
contain very heavy downpours, will be Sunday afternoon and evening.
Otherwise, look for hit and miss, mainly afternoon and evening
showers and storms right through Monday.

A cold front will be passing through Sunday night or Monday.

Minimum RH will stay above 50% most days. Wind will also be light
each day through at least Monday, mostly 10 mph or less.
